SAMHSA Certified Opioid Treatment - Drug and Alcohol Rehab Centers - Bronwood, GA.

The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ration, "SAMHSA" for short, is the government agency in charge of efforts to advance the behavioral health of the nation. One of its obligations is the oversight of opioid rehabilitation facilities, which are programs who provide medication-assisted treatment (MAT) to clients who are experiencing opioid addiction and dependency. Medications administered are drugs like methadone, buprenorphine and other drugs which stop withdrawal and curb cravings for opioid dependent clients. SAMSHA certified opioid rehab facilities in Bronwood are programs who are legally permitted to give out the medications used in MAT being they maintain their certification and always maintain the necessary requirements. One of these requirements is that MAT individuals must also receive auxiliary services aside from medication such as counseling or behavioral therapy.

An opioid rehabilitation program can get their initial certification while working towards becoming fully accredited, but must become fully accredited within a year. Opioid treatment facilities authorized by SAMSHA must be licensed by the state in which they operate. Likewise, they need to list themselves with the Drug Enforcement Administration via a local DEA branch. Once an opioid rehab center is certified, they need to get re-certified every year or every 3 years depending on the kind of certification that was granted.
